What Does Housing Loan Eligibility Mean?

Housing loan eligibility refers to the maximum loan amount you can claim based on your financial profile. Lenders evaluate multiple parameters to determine whether you can comfortably repay the loan amount in the given tenure.

These parameters typically include:

  • Income level and stability
  • Age and remaining working years
  • Existing financial obligations
  • Credit history
  • Employment type

Key Factors That Influence Housing Loan Eligibility

1. Income and Repayment Capacity

Your monthly income plays a central role in eligibility assessment. Lenders examine your net income and compare it with existing EMIs or liabilities. A lower debt-to-income ratio is appreciated by the lenders.

Salaried applicants are assessed based on employment continuity and employer credibility. Self-employed applicants are evaluated on business stability and income consistency.

2. Age

Applicants typically fall within an age range of approximately 21 to 70 years at loan maturity. Younger applicants easily qualify for longer tenures, which can increase the eligible loan amount by dividing repayments over an extended period.

3. Credit Behaviour

Your credit score reflects your past repayment discipline. Before you apply for a home loan, it is advisable to know your CIBIL online. A score of 750 or above is generally considered favourable.

4. Existing Financial Obligations

Outstanding loans and credit card dues reduce disposable income. Clearing smaller liabilities before applying can enhance housing loan eligibility significantly.

Document Required for Home Loan Processing

Always keep your documents ready before even applying for home loan. This will speed up your application process: Here are some of the documents you’ll need:

Identity and Address Proof

  • Aadhaar Card
  • PAN Card
  • Passport or Voter ID
  • Utility bills or rental agreement

Income Proof

For salaried applicants:

  • Recent salary slips
  • Bank statements
  • Form 16 or income tax returns

For self-employed applicants:

  • Income tax returns
  • Audited financial statements
  • Proof of business continuity

Property Documents

  • Agreement for sale
  • Title deed
  • Approved building plan
  • Property tax receipts
